Plain-English summary

South Essex Sewerage District petitioned for review of an NPDES permit issued by EPA Region 1. The Board stayed the proceedings while the parties explored settlement, and the parties then reached an agreement. After Region 1 issued a draft permit modification and satisfied its obligations under the settlement, South Essex asked to dismiss the petition. The Board granted that motion and dismissed the appeal without deciding the permit's merits.

                    ORDER GRANTING PETITIONER’S MOTION
                     AND DISMISSING PETITION FOR REVIEW



                                   Decided July 15, 2026




   Before Environmental Appeals Judges Aaron P. Avila and Ammie Roseman-Orr.

   Order of the Board by Judge Avila:

   The South Essex Sewerage District (“SESD”) petitioned the Environmental Appeals

Board to review a National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System permit issued by U.S. EPA

Region 1 to SESD. Shortly afterward, the Board granted a request for a stay of the proceedings

in this matter so that the parties could explore the possibility of a negotiated settlement. Order

Granting Stay of Proceedings and Directing Status Report (Jan. 29, 2026); see Order Extending

Stay of Proceedings and Directing Status Report (Mar. 23, 2026); Second Order Extending Stay

of Proceedings and Directing Status Report (May 5, 2026). The parties reached a settlement

agreement, and SESD has now filed a motion to dismiss its petition for review under 40 C.F.R.

§ 124.19(k). South Essex Sewerage District’s Assented Motion to Dismiss at 1 (July 13, 2026)
(stating that Region 1 has “issued a draft permit modification for public notice and satisfied [its]

obligations under the settlement agreement” and that SESD’s request to dismiss the petition for

review is consistent with the terms of the settlement agreement). Based on the representations in

the motion, the Board GRANTS SESD’s motion and the petition for review in the above-

captioned matter is hereby DISMISSED.

   So ordered.
